1 Fireworks CS4 Tutorial Part 1: Intro This Adobe Fireworks CS4 Tutorial will help you familiarize yourself with this image editing software and help you create a layout for a website. Fireworks CS4 is the best graphics editing software for the web. It is easy to use and allows you to quickly create images optimized for the web. Some of the latest features in Fireworks CS4 is the ability to export your layout into HTML, CSS and sliced images completely web-ready. In this tutorial we will create a website layout and slice the images for use in a website. This is the layout we will create:
2 Part 2: Create a new document in Fireworks The first step to creating a web design in Fireworks CS4 is to create a New Document. To do this: 1. Open Fireworks CS4 2. File > New 3. In the panel that opens, specify the width, height, resolution and background color of your web design. 4. The width depends on what screen resolution you are designing for e.g is the most commonly used screen resolution right now so you can design for a width of 1000 pixels and a height of When designing for a website specify the value 72 pixels/ inch for Resolution. Save the document with an appropriate name like Layout.png. Fireworks File are in the PNG format.
3 Part 3: Fireworks Tools Let us create a web design in Fireworks CS4. Once you create a new document in Fireworks CS4 you will get a blank canvas. Take a look at the tools panel. If you cannot see it, open it from: Window > Tools Take some time to explore the various tools. Additional tools can be found in some cases by clicking on the tiny triangle below the tool. 4 Part 4: Create a website design in Fireworks It is now time to design how your website will look. What will the layout of the pages be? If the home page looks different you will need to design it separately. You will need to design a logo, a menu area, maybe a submenu area, decide on which photos to use if any and how they should look (size, dimensions and special effects if any). You might want to design bullets for your website and icons for your menu options as well. You will also want to decide on the style of your content including headings, sub-headings, body text, links and so on. You will want to design a footer area with some basic website copyright information and maybe even a few links as well.

6 Part 6: Logo Making with Fireworks Logo making with Fireworks is extremely easy since it has image editing as well as vector drawing tools. You can insert an image and edit it however it is better to use the vector drawing tools as well as the text tool to create your logo. This is so you can expand the logo to any size you might need in future. Let s make this logo in Fireworks: Step 1 Using the text tool, choose a good font and type out the word logo. In this case I have used the font 28 days later however you can use any font you like. You can change the font, select the font size and color in the Properties window. If you cannot see the Properties window you can access it from Window > Properties. Click to enlarge the above picture Step 2 Use the Pen tool to create the 4 arrowheads. Fill them with the colors red and orange respectively. To close the shape you create with the Pen tool, double click. You can then give it the color you want by first selecting the entire shape with the Pointer tool.
7 Then choose the desired Fill color. Use the zoom tool to enlarge the canvas so you can clearly see and easily manipulate the vector shape to suit your needs. Double click on the zoom tool to get back to the actual view (100% scale). To move an individual point (node) in the shape you create with the pen tool, select and move it with the Sub selection tool. That particular point will get a blue fill color while the other points will only have a blue stoke color. That s it! You re done! Congratulation you have made you first logo with Fireworks.
8 Part 7: Fireworks Designs Now that you have created the logo in Fireworks designs for the website can be created. Remember the website design we set out to create in Fireworks? Here it is again: Let s first create the header area. To do this create a rectangle using the Rectangle vector tool. Since we already creates the logo you will notice that the rectangle is created over the logo hiding it from view. To take the rectangle behind the logo: Open the Layers window. You can do this from Window > Layers You will notice that the Rectangle layer is right on top. Drag this layer to the bottom It will move behind the logo
9 You will notice that the color of the header area behind the logo is not a flat color it is actually a gradient between 2 colors. To give this gradient effect: Select the rectangle Open the Properties window (Window> Properties) Next to the Fill color, click on the fill category drop down menu and select Gradient. From the Gradient sub selection options that opens up select Linear. To choose the gradient colors:
10 Click on the tiny arrow below the fill color in the Properties window (marked with a small red circle as the bottom of the image above). In the panel that opens up, choose an orange color by clicking on the little marker on the left (circled in red in the picture above) and a yellow color for the little marker on the right. You will get a nice gradient for the header area behind the logo. Now create another rectangle for the menu area. Give it a linear gradient from a red to an orange color. Use the text tool to create the menu options with appropriate spaces between the options Home, About Us, Services and Contact Us. In the Properties window select the font, size and color you want.
11 Part 8: Fireworks Tips Now it s time for more Fireworks tips. We have created the logo and the header area along with the main menu area. We will now create the submenu area. To do this we will use the Rectangle tool to create a rectangle with rounded edges. We will give it a gradient from left to right (as opposed to top to bottom ). Then we will put in some sample link text and bullets. Step 1: Make the Rectangle with Rounded Edges To do this: Use the Rectangle tool to create a rectangle. In the Properties window, give it a corner roundness of 11. Step 2: Linear Gradient from left to right To give the rectangle a linear gradient from left to right instead of top to bottom: Give the rectangle a linear gradient with the colors desired. Click on the rectangle. You will see a black line with 2 points (one on either end). To change the direction of the gradient, move the black gradient line to appear from left to right. You will notice that moving the circle end will move the entire line (and therefore the gradient), while moving the square end will allow you to increase or decrease the size of the gradient and rotate the gradient direction.
12 Step 3: Put in the sub link text with the bullets Use the Text tool to type out the sub link text. Select the required font, size and color from the Properties window. To insert the bullets open the Special Characters window (next to the Properties window) and select the required bullet. Sample Text for the Content Area We will now put in sample content to get a better idea how our layout will look with textual content. Fireworks makes this really easy. To insert sample text: Commands > Text > Lorem Ipsum Sample text will be inserted Give it the font, size and color you want in the Properties window
13 To adjust the size of the text area, click and drag the blue nodes at the corners and sides of the text area.
14 Insert an Image To insert an image into Fireworks: File > Import > browse for the image file > Open Your cursor will change Click on the canvas where you would like to place the image The image will be placed there You can get cheap stock photos for use in your website. Add some more sample text and decide on the styles for the main heading as well as the subheading. Create the Footer Area Create a rectangle with a linear gradient Put in the copyright text 2009 Company Name. All Rights Reserved. Insert the copyright symbol from the Special Characters window. 15 Part 9: Fireworks Web Ready Images To create Fireworks web ready images for use in our website we will need to slice the required parts of our layout. Create the Slices To do this we will use the slice tool. Makes slices for: Logo Header background (this will tile horizontally so just a small vertical slice will do) Menu options Home, About Us, Services, Contact Us (this is required because the menu buttons use a special font which will not be available on all computers and therefore should be images rather than HTML) Menu background (will tile horizontally) Submenu background (will tile vertically) Submenu top background (required because of the curved edges of the rectangle which cannot be created in HTML) Submenu bottom background Picture Footer background This is how it will look:
16 Name the Slices In the Layers window you will notice that a new layer is created for each slice in the Web Layer. Give each slice an appropriate name. Optimize the Slices for the Web The images used in a website have to be optimized to load quickly yet look good. The smaller the file size of the image the quicker it will load. The commonly used image formats are.gif and.jpg. A good rule of thumb is to use.gif compression for images with flat colors and.jpg compression for images with lots of colours like photographs etc. To optimize the images: Select the slice Open the Optimize window (Window > Optimize) Select JPEG or GIF from the drop down menu and adjust the quality settings
17 You can preview how the slice will look with those settings by selecting it in the Preview mode. You can also see the size of the slice at the bottom of the Preview window.
18 Export the Slices You are now ready to export the slices for use in your website. To export the slices: File > Export Select the folder you want to export the images to. Usually a folder called images Select Images Only for the Export option Select Export Slices for the Slices option Deselect Selected slices only and Include areas without slices Click the Save button Your sliced images will be exported Congratulations! You have used Fireworks to create your website slices. Now that you have your website layout and images ready you can use an HTML editor like Dreamweaver to create your website page.
